An ABC News report reveals that President Trump might accept a lavish Boeing 787 Dreamliner gifted by Qatar. The aircraft, previously owned by the Qatari royal family, is speculated to be luxurious with gold accents and luxury features. While the Department of Justice cleared the gift of being considered bribery, it has sparked controversy, especially among conservatives. Critics highlight Qatar's connections to terrorism and question the implications on American foreign relations and ethics, considering the jet's intended future use as Air Force One before its transfer to the Trump Library.
"The Qatari government is not our friend, cooperates with Iran and its proxies, and funds terrorism and pro-terror propaganda around the world," radio host Erick Erickson wrote on X.
"There are news reports that Qatar is buying us a jet. Who knows. But Qatar must stop buying our colleges and universities and spreading their anti-American, Jew-hating propaganda," said Fox News host Mark Levin.
